Rok settles out of court in dispute with Mark Kay over 拢5.025m claim for bonus payments

ROK has paid a former director 拢1.25m in a dispute over bonus payments.

The out of court settlement came after former director Mark Kay issued a claim of 拢5.025m for amounts allegedly owed under bonus provisions in his contract.

The 好色先生TV and maintenance services provider said it paid 拢815,000 in full and final settlement of legal proceedings, plus interest, legal fees and termination of Kay鈥檚 contract, which amounted to 拢1.25m.

Kay ceased to be a director of Rok in October 2004.
